Output 8b31e3467d1c13cec4f9a84f8f7cf59537f079f64a0089f23fe5c74176510871:2

value
892771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67551f8de4ef88dc7fd3a336743c08c5ac02cf5 OP_EQUAL
address
3MEy59RojcbfTyyULN5GVUeQ4AcuqnMd5Z
transaction
8b31e3467d1c13cec4f9a84f8f7cf59537f079f64a0089f23fe5c74176510871
confirmations
368844
spent
true